17 open source wiki engine/software
MediaWiki is a free and open source server based wiki engine written in PHP developed by Wikipedia. MediaWiki is an extremely powerful, scalable software and a feature-rich wiki implementation, that uses PHP to process and display data stored in its MySQL database. Pages use MediaWiki’s wiki-text format, so that users without knowledge of XHTML or CSS can edit pages easily...
